AO61 LVC is a 2012 Honda Cr-v in Grey with a 2,199c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2012 Honda Cr-v models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.8% with a typical mileage of 63,480 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Cr-v f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 62,925 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O61 LVC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Cr-v typ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 14 years old, this Honda Cr-v is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
